WebIn England, of people diagnosed with myeloma between 2013 and 2024 [ CRUK, 2024 ]: 82.7% survived for 1 year or more. 52.3% survived their disease for 5 years or more. 29.1% are predicted to survive their disease for 10 years or more. Survival is related to many factors including age and stage at diagnosis. WebMyeloma signs and symptoms. bone pain or a broken bone without an obvious injury. frequent infections or an infection that is difficult to overcome. tiredness, shortness of breath or a racing heart. kidney problems. heavy nosebleeds or easy bruising. feeling sick, drowsy or confused. abnormal blood counts. Web24 Nov 2024 · One 2016 study looked at relapse rates in 511 participants with multiple myeloma following treatment in 2006–2014. Within a 12-month period, 16% of the participants experienced early relapse.
